Abstract :
A boundary assembling (BA) method is presented for Chinese entity-mention recognition. Given a sentence, instead of recognizing entity mentions in a unitary style, the authors´ BA method first detects boundaries of entity mentions and then assembles detected boundaries into entity-mention candidates. Each candidate is further assessed by a classifier trained on nonlocal features. This method can make better use of nonlocal features and effectively recognize nested entity mentions. Using the ACE 2005 Chinese corpus, the authors´ experimental results show an improvement over state-of-the-art techniques, outperforming existing methods in F-score by 5 percent for entity-mention detection and 4.23 percent for entity-mention recognition.
